At Dr Sknn, we provide an advanced Fractional CO2 Laser treatment to vastly improve the look of scars caused by a variety of factors. This procedure encourages the growth of fresh skin in the dermis and epidermis through ablation and thermal result. The laser is applied using a precise, organised pattern with even spacing between each pulse, protecting the tissue in between and speeding up the healing process. Our mid-infrared CO2 laser at 10,600 nm is particularly effective in tackling a selection of aesthetic issues such as undesired scars, fine lines, wrinkles, discolouration, pigmentary lesions, large pores, texture, sun damage, stretch marks, and slackened skin. This treatment can enhance skin clarity, depth and hydration, leading to a younger-looking and healthier complexion. At Dr Sknn, prior to CO2 Ablative Fractional Laser Treatment a detailed consultation will be held that covers your medical history and physical assessment along with photographs. This allows you to ask any queries, expectations, outcomes or worries you may have. Ahead of the treatment, any potential risks and post-treatment advice relating to CO2 Ablative Fractional Laser Treatment will be discussed in depth and a consent form signed to ensure you understand the procedure fully. When the area is being treated for the first time, a patch test will be done to determine if it is suitable. Furthermore, if your skin type is identified as III+, it might be necessary to use a topical serum for four weeks before the treatment to prepare the skin. At Dr Sknn, safety and suitability for the procedure are of the utmost importance and a full consultation will be conducted to decide whether you are eligible for CO2 Ablative Fractional Laser Treatment. A successful patch test after 48 hours will enable the treatment to take place. Though, if you have certain medications in your medical history, the patch testing period may be extended up to two weeks. If your skin type is rated III+, a topical product may be required for four weeks before the treatment.
